With over 600 million people lacking reliable electricity access in sub-Saharan Africa, solar PV installation has become a game-changer. West Africa's abundant sunshine – averaging 5-6 peak sunlight hours daily – creates ideal conditions for solar energy adoption.

Grid-scale solar developments (GSSD) (also called utility-scale solar) are often called "solar arrays. " They normally consist of about one hundred to several thousand acres of ground-mounted solar panels that produce electricity for transmission into the power grid for use.
